About Tiffany Diamond Solitaire Rings

The Tiffany setting was first created in 1886 and has long become a time-honored favorite among women. With all of the attention being drawn to the beauty, sparkle and clarity of a single diamond, this setting has become their signature design. Its simple and classic design does not use dramatic or elaborate arrangements which take away from the focal point of the diamond.

The Tiffany setting securely holds the largest part of the diamond (also known as the girdle) in either four or six prongs. This design allows for the stone to be elevated high above the band, while the prongs are perfectly spaced to compliment the symmetrical cut of the diamond.

Tiffany diamond solitaire rings are by far the most popular in jewelry stores. Often times men will propose with this type of ring, as it is considered a safe choice–particularly if the proposal is a complete surprise. Jewelry stores encourage men to use this type of setting as a trial ring for proposing, with the option for the bride to return and pick out her desired setting. However, many brides-to-be are happy with the setting and end up showcasing their creativity in the wedding band’s design.

The Benefits of Tiffany Diamond Solitaire Rings

  • Although it is a simple diamond ring, its elegant understated design is especially ideal for displaying a top-notch diamond. The level of elevation and openings between each of the four or six prongs allow for the maximum amount of light to be caught and reflected, creating dazzling fire and sparkle.
  • With either four or six prongs, the setting is both secure and beautiful. The spacing between the fine-quality prongs allows for durability and style.
  • Tiffany diamond solitaire rings are the top choice for showcasing a diamond and can make the diamond appear to be of a larger carat weight.
  • The diamonds used in Tiffany settings are of impeccable quality, enabling the true beauty of the stone to be best shown off in its high, open setting.

Purchasing Tiffany Diamond Solitaire Rings

Only Tiffany & Co. offer the original Tiffany solitaire ring.  However, with the high demand of this particular ring (and desire for a more affordable price-point), many jewelry stores offer beautiful variations or even near replications. Here are a few things to look for if you’re interested in a different jewelry, but want the same look of a Tiffany solitaire:
  • High quality platinum or white gold prongs
  • Symmetrical space between four or six prongs
  • Diamond should be level to the prongs
  • Rounded, smooth prongs in order to prevent snagging
  • High quality diamonds look best–note that because of the openness of the setting, imperfections on the sides of the diamond may be noticeable. (Just ensure that the diamond is “eye-flawless”).
  • Solitaires are the least expensive of diamond engagement rings. However, signature Tiffany settings can run approximately $3,540 for a .50 carat diamond.
